Job Description

We are seeking a detail-oriented and efficient Duty Engineer to join our team in Chennai India. As a Duty Engineer you will play a crucial role in maintaining the operational excellence of our facility by ensuring all building systems are functioning optimally and addressing maintenance issues promptly.

  • Conduct routine inspections and maintenance of HVAC plumbing electrical and mechanical systems to ensure optimal performance
  • Respond promptly and professionally to guest and staff maintenance requests resolving issues efficiently
  • Maintain accurate records of maintenance activities repairs and equipment performance using computerized systems
  • Implement and support preventive maintenance schedules to minimize downtime and extend equipment life
  • Monitor energy usage and actively participate in energy conservation initiatives
  • Respond to emergencies such as power failures equipment breakdowns and safety hazards with a sense of urgency
  • Collaborate with contractors and vendors for specialized repairs and servicing
  • Ensure compliance with health safety and environmental standards including local building codes and regulations
  • Assist in supervising maintenance staff or technicians during shifts as required
  • Participate in shift rotations including nights weekends and holidays demonstrating flexibility and resilience

Qualifications :

  • Diploma or certification in Mechanical/Electrical Engineering or a related technical field
  • Minimum of 2-3 years of experience in a similar role preferably in a hotel or hospitality environment
  • Comprehensive knowledge of building systems including electrical HVAC plumbing and fire safety
  • Proficiency in reading and interpreting technical drawings and manuals
  • Strong problem-solving and troubleshooting skills with a detail-oriented approach
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ills with a focus on customer service
  • Familiarity with local building codes and regulations in Chennai
  • Knowledge of energy conservation practices and their implementation
  • Basic computer skills for record-keeping reporting and using maintenance management systems
  • Ability to work collaboratively in a team environment
  • Willingness to work in shifts and respond to emergency situations demonstrating flexibility and resilience
  • Physical ability to perform maintenance tasks and handle equipment
